Brighton Met College, part of the Chichester College Group Ref: BRTN8048 Sessional Assessor – T-Level in Education and Early Years Approx 12 hours per week, fixed term until July 2025 Are you an experienced and passionate Childcare or Early Years professional looking to share your skills with the next generation of teachers, nursery nurses and child carers? Brighton Met College is looking for a Sessional Assessor in Education and Childcare to join our team and help share our students’ future careers by supporting the development of employability skills and vocational competence. As our T Level in Education and Early Years Assessor, you will visit students on placement and assess their progress and performance. You will also liaise with relevant employers as part of the assessment for the T level and undertake a range of duties that support the successful running of Early Years work placements. Minimum Requirements: Level 2 (or equivalent) English and Maths A relevant professional qualification at Level 3 or above - Diploma in Childcare and Education, Level 3 NVQ in Early Years, Care and Education, Children and Young People’s Workforce, NNEB Experience of working with students and assessing vocational practice Skills in assessing the progress of students Knowledge of Child Care/Early Years programmes and the qualification framework Knowledge of the kind of skills and personal qualities needed by students for the employment sector/organisations for which they are being prepared The working pattern for this role will be discussed at interview. The Chichester College Group is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children. All posts are subject to an enhanced Disclosure and Barring Service check, which may include a check of the barred lists, and any relevant overseas checks and a self-declaration relating to the disqualification regulations. We vigorously pursue all references and safeguarding checks to ensure applicants are suitable to work with young people.
